The Namelist-variable IELV = 1 option inputs ELEV cell-centered elevations for one-dimensional (1D) hydraulic and HTSTR components. TRAC-P then internally evaluates interface-centered GRAVs. TRAC-P checks that GRAVs evaluated from input ELEVs for the HTSTR component and GRAVs input directly under the Namelist-variable IELV = 0 option for 1D hydraulic and HTSTR components lie within the range of {minus}1.0 to 1.0. TRAC-P, however, does not check that GRAVs evaluated from ELEVs input for 1D hydraulic components lie in this range. Knolls Atomic Power Laboratory requested that TRAC-P Version 5.4.28 be programmed to perform this GRAV value check. Update FXGRAV checks that GRAVs evaluated from input ELEVs for one-dimensional hydraulic components lie in the value range of {minus}1.0 to 1.0
